Paris 2024: Benjamin Azamati paired with World Champion Noah Lyles in 100 Metre Men’s semis

Ghana’s fastest man Benjamin Azamati will race the reigning World Athletics Champion Noah Lyles for a place in the final of the 2024 Olympic Games Men’s 100 Metres.

The semifinals of the high profile event takes place on Sunday, August 4 with the first of three heats commencing at 18:05 GMT. The top two finishers in each heat progress automatically to the final with the two fastest time holders progressing too to complete the field.

Azamati qualified to the semis after finishing second in his heat with a time of 10.08 seconds behind Jamaica’s Kishane Thompson’s time of 10.00 seconds while Lyles progressed with a second place finish in his heat with a time of 10.04 seconds. Lyles won the 2023 World Championship with a time of 9.83 seconds.

In Heat 3, Abdul-Rasheed Saminu of Ghana has been drawn against 2021 World Athletics Champion Fred Kerley, Africa’s record holder Ferdinand Omanyala and Kishane Thompson is the world’s fastest this year after clocking a time of 9.77 seconds.

Benjamin Azamati of Ghana (Photo by Steve Christo – Corbis/Corbis via Getty Images)

Ghana is gunning for its first medal win at this year’s Olympics with Azamati and Saminu also in contention for a medal in the Men’s 4×100 Metre Relay as members of Team Ghana. Scroll down to view full schedule of 2024 Olympics Men’s 100 Metres semifinals.
